The video tutorial explains the concept of scale factors, including linear, area, and volume scale factors. It provides examples and calculations to demonstrate how these factors are used to enlarge or reduce shapes. The tutorial also covers the application of scale factors in unit conversion, particularly within the metric system. Key rules of thumb are highlighted, such as multiplying lengths by a scale factor k results in areas being multiplied by k squared and volumes by k cubed.
